Dr. Richard Weiner Joins Spine Treatment Centers of America

The Spine Treatment Centers of America are teaming up with Richard Weiner, MD, to bring minimally invasive spine surgery to its Dallas location.

Dr. Weiner is a board-certified neurological surgeon who owns Dallas Neurological and Spine Associates. His clinical interests focus on the application of minimally invasive surgical solutions to chronic back and neck pathologies, including spinal stenosis and degenerative disc disease.

Dr. Weiner also serves as a clinical associate professor of neurosurgery at the University of Texas Southwestern and has been the chief of neurosurgery at Presbyterian Hospital of Dallas.

He received his medical degree from the Medical College of Wisconsin. He completed an internship at the University of Southern California Medical Center and a residency in neurosurgery at New York University Medical Center.
